Ubuntu 如何在debian中安装apt软件包?

Ubuntu 如何在debian中安装apt软件包?,ubuntu,debian,apt,Ubuntu,Debian,Apt,我正在使用Debian GNU/Linux 6.0.4(挤压)。误将所有apt文件从我的操作系统中删除。我正在尝试安装软件包“apt_0.9.7.1_amd64.deb”。但在安装软件包时,我遇到以下错误: Unpacking replacement apt ... dpkg: dependency problems prevent configuration of apt: apt depends on libapt-pkg4.12 (>= 0.9.7.1); however: P

我正在使用Debian GNU/Linux 6.0.4(挤压)。误将所有apt文件从我的操作系统中删除。我正在尝试安装软件包“apt_0.9.7.1_amd64.deb”。但在安装软件包时,我遇到以下错误:

Unpacking replacement apt ...
dpkg: dependency problems prevent configuration of apt:
 apt depends on libapt-pkg4.12 (>= 0.9.7.1); however:
  Package libapt-pkg4.12 is not installed.
 apt depends on libstdc++6 (>= 4.6); however:
  Version of libstdc++6 on system is 4.4.5-8.
 apt depends on debian-archive-keyring; however:
  Package debian-archive-keyring is not installed.
dpkg: error processing apt (--install):
 dependency problems - leaving unconfigured
Processing triggers for man-db ...
Errors were encountered while processing:
 apt
有人知道如何安装apt软件包吗?或者是否有其他方法安装该软件包

当使用任何命令如sudo apt get update等时,我得到了一个错误

apt : Depends: debian-archive-keyring but it is not going to be installed
对于安装debian archive keyring,我需要apt,对于apt,我需要debian archive keyring。
请建议任何解决方案。

尝试
su
在tty环境(无gui)中生根,然后尝试
apt-get-update
和/或
apt-get-f-install

有能力尝试或下载该特定软件包(必要时带有依赖项)并使用dpkg-i安装您下载的软件包*.deb

因为
apt
不再出现在您的系统上,您必须手动修复此问题

对我来说,这在Ubuntu 13.10上起到了作用:

下载的
apt_1.0.1ubuntu2.5_amd64.deb

尝试使用dpkg安装它:

sudo dpkg-i apt_1.0.1ubuntu2.5_amd64.deb

您可能会遇到如下错误:

Unpacking apt (from apt_1.0.1ubuntu2.5_amd64.deb) ...
dpkg: dependency problems prevent configuration of apt:
 apt depends on libapt-pkg4.12 (>= 0.9.16); however:
  Version of libapt-pkg4.12:amd64 on system is 0.9.9.1~ubuntu3.
要修复此问题,请从下载正确版本的依赖项

并安装:

sudo dpkg-i libapt-pkg4.12_1.0.1ubuntu2.5_amd64.deb

现在您应该能够重复第一个命令并安装
apt

注意:根据您的Ubuntu版本,软件包版本可能会有所不同。要找到正确的版本,请使用标题中的菜单选择您的ubuntu版本:

试试这一行,当我遇到依赖性问题时,它在大多数时候都对我有帮助


输入以下命令
sudo dpkg安装-f
。我希望这有帮助。

你好。这个网站是为编程问题。你可能想试试,或者。这怎么行<代码>apt在系统上不存在。您需要使用
dpkg
手动安装
deb
。apt get在核心Debian系统上可用时间的99%。但也有可能下载apt deb文件并通过dpkg手动安装。此外,当它对其他人有用时,down vote是不道德的!这不是道德问题,而是与问题相关的问题。问题明确指出,
错误地删除了所有apt文件
,这使得它属于
apt
不可用的其他1%。修改你的答案,把这一点考虑在内,我将取消我的否决票。这里没有个人信息。根据日志,
apt
可用(否则错误为
未找到命令
);只是缺少依赖项,通过
dpkg
apt get-f install安装依赖项将解决此问题。